Using Memetic Algorithms for Optimal Calibration of Automotive Internal Combustion Enginesntrol units is optimized. It is shown that in all cases MAs that work on locally optimal solutions calculated by the corresponding HCs significantly improve former results using Genetic Algorithms (GAs). The algorithms have been successfully applied at BMW Group Munich.

-Fitness Landscapes and Memetic Algorithms with Greedy Operators and ,-opt Local Searchbination operator, are compared on three types of .-landscapes. In accordance with the landscape analysis, the MAs with recombination perform better than the MAs with mutation for landscapes with low epistasis. Moreover, the MAs are shown to be superior to previously proposed MAs using 1-opt local search.
